The Adventures of Mabel by Harry Thurston Peck [Professionally HAND-TYPED and NOT photocopied or scanned pages put in book form! Including more than 30 illustrations.] This book was originally published in 1896 and tells the story of Mabel, a five-year-old girl who is always getting herself in tricky situations, but read how her previous acts of kindness are repaid. Find out how she helps the King of all Lizards and is rewarded with the ability to converse with animals, which leads her into many exciting encounters. Follow her adventures as she makes friends with lots of different creatures. And see what happens when she becomes involved with Wolves, Robbers, Giants and Brownies. This wonderful story of kindness and bravery was recently highlighted in the television series, Better Call Saul, when the young Chuck McGill was shown reading this story to his little brother Jimmy. Ideal bedtime reading for children of four and above.

The Adventures of Mabel tells the story of Mabel, a fierce young girl afraid of no one, that finds herself in various adventures, including talking to animals, becoming friends with a Lizard King, meeting giant creatures and many more. Harry Thurston Peck, then known as "Rafford Pyke" published this illustrated fantasy children's book as early as 1896, yet the stories are as relevant as ever for mischievous young readers eager to travel in a world unknown, full of mystery and magic.

Mabel is a young girl who lives in the countryside near the woods. One day, she decides to explore the land with the help of the animals who live amongst the trees, fields and ponds. As Mabel's adventures in the forest and beyond, she learns a lot about the kinds of creatures who live there. The strong and speedy horse, the agile wolf, and the brave and faithful dog - the sorts of animals Mabel befriends are encountered or depended on by people through good and bad times. With her friends, Mabel protects her family against wrongdoers. Her old grandma, a kind and goodly soul, is vulnerable - it's up to Mabel and her companions to keep their house and home safe. This edition of Mabel's adventures includes nine drawings by Harry Rountree, so that young readers can understand and follow what happens.
